Related Product Features:
Designed for aerospace and military equipment with nonlinear stiffness for superior vibration control.
Fabricated via constant-tension helical winding of high-strength stainless steel wire ropes.
Efficient vibration isolation in the 50-2000 Hz high-frequency range with ≥90% vibration reduction efficiency.
Passed environmental testing per GJB 150-2009 military standard, ensuring performance stability in extreme conditions.
No creep or ageing, with high internal damping and a very wide temperature range.
Extremely rugged construction and long lifespan, unaffected by chemical agents, seawater, ozone, or UV rays.
Excellent combined shock and vibration isolation, suitable for broadband vibration scenarios.

What is the vibration reduction efficiency of the JGX-0956A-75A Wire Rope Vibration Isolator?
The vibration transmissibility is ≤10%, equivalent to a vibration reduction efficiency of ≥90%.
How does the JGX-0956A-75A perform under extreme temperatures?
It passes environmental testing per GJB 150-2009, with stiffness decay rate ≤8% and damping ratio fluctuation ≤10% after temperature cycles between -55°C and 150°C.
